CVE-2025-2013 is a Use-After-Free vulnerability in Ashlar-Vellum Cobalt's CO file parsing, allowing remote code execution. This high-severity vulnerability (CVSS 7.8) requires user interaction, such as opening a malicious file, to exploit, leading to potential complete compromise of confidentiality, integrity, and availability. While no public exploits or active exploitation have been observed, and community discussion is minimal, the FAUCET Risk Score of 75/100 indicates a significant potential threat. Organizations using Ashlar-Vellum Cobalt should monitor for updates and apply patches promptly.
